either way, a 10 mile drive to work and back plus short drives on the weekends dont allow the car to reach to its full operating temperature for very long periods of time which puts more stress on the engine. Even if its synthetic oil, it should always be changed on a regular 3 months/3,000 miles basis.

No it doesn't. I've ran most engine oil before but in the end I stick to Pennzoil or mobil 1, whichever one is cheaper. Keep in mind that I also do some serious stop and go driving every day. Oil analysis will show that the pennzoil synthetic will have good wear. Basically any oil that passes federal standard is good enough. After all, your car was built to be ran under those oil.
